Not to be a party pooper but this is really SOP for NK.
In the past, they've deliberately antagonized SK and even the USA. There have been SK, and US servicemen deliberate shot by them, there was a SK airliner shot down - they do this as a means of brutal "diplomacy" .When the West, Japan, and South Korea protest, North Korea goes hardline and they are then pretty much placated and appeased (check your history). This time, with their insistence on keeping their nuclear program going, I think they did this to literally to test the reaction now.
I could be wrong of course.. but, I do strongly believe that this is just bidness as usual.
